Doylestown Family Medicine

At Doylestown Family Medicine, board-certified Dr. Schnur and his staff perform comprehensive services such as routine and emergency medical care, dermatology, and gynecological care. They perform nonsurgical sports and orthopedic treatments and offer vaccinations as well, treating both adults and children. For their patients’ convenience, they also offer office hours every other Saturday and two evenings a week.
